THE CTHULHUS: EVAPR8

April 18th, 2011 · No Comments

Travis Cthulhu just got a whole lot more sinister on The Cthulhus’ third CD-R release, EVAPR8. This collection of sci-fi sound poems, strung together with bedroom rock, bent electronics and musique concrète, sounds less like Wavves and more like Trout Mask Replica or early Zappa, with perhaps an assist from Bruce Haack on drum machines, which could easily be lifted from a Baldwin ’70s home organ.

Wavves, Abe Vigoda, The Growlers @ The Glass House

September 13th, 2010 · 1 Comment

Wavves – photography by Zane Roessell On August 13, Wavves played at Pomona’s Glass House. Sensing the “Friday the Thirteenth” spirit in the air Nathan Williams and company played a rowdy set, replete with crowd surfing and stage diving. Wavves’ signature surf goth sound had the crowd surging against the barricades like a roiling tempest.
